What Is Mileage?

Mileage refers to the distance a vehicle can travel using a specific amount of fuel. In India, vehicle mileage is commonly measured in kilometres per litre (km/l or kmpl) for petrol and diesel cars and bikes, while CNG vehicles are generally measured in km/kg.

For electric vehicles, efficiency is usually expressed as kilometres per kWh (km/kWh) or kWh per 100 km.

For example, if your car travels 450 km using 30 litres of petrol:

Mileage = 450 ÷ 30 = 15 km/l

A higher mileage generally means that the vehicle uses less fuel to cover the same distance, resulting in a lower fuel cost per kilometre.

How To Calculate Car Mileage

The basic mileage formula is:

Car Mileage (km/l) = Distance Travelled (km) ÷ Fuel Consumed (litres)

For example, if you drive 300 km and your car consumes 20 litres of petrol:

300 ÷ 20 = 15 km/l

Your car's real-world mileage is therefore 15 km/l.

The same calculation can be used for petrol cars, diesel cars, motorcycles, scooters and other vehicles. For CNG vehicles, use the amount of CNG consumed in kilograms to calculate km/kg.

How To Calculate Fuel Cost Per Kilometre

Once you know your vehicle's mileage and fuel price, you can calculate its fuel cost per kilometre.

Fuel Cost Per Km = Fuel Price Per Litre ÷ Mileage (km/l)

For example, assume:

  • Car mileage = 15 km/l
  • Petrol price = ₹100/litre

Fuel cost per kilometre:

₹100 ÷ 15 = ₹6.67/km

This means the car costs approximately ₹6.67 in fuel for every kilometre travelled.

For a 100 km journey, the estimated fuel cost would be approximately ₹667.

How To Calculate Fuel Cost For A Trip

You can calculate the estimated fuel cost of a road trip using:

Fuel Required = Trip Distance ÷ Vehicle Mileage

Then:

Trip Fuel Cost = Fuel Required × Fuel Price

For example, if you are travelling 600 km in a car that delivers 15 km/l:

Fuel Required = 600 ÷ 15 = 40 litres

If petrol costs ₹100 per litre:

Trip Fuel Cost = 40 × ₹100 = ₹4,000

This makes the Trip Calculator useful for estimating the cost of road trips, weekend drives, highway journeys, daily commutes and long-distance travel.

What Is Real-World Mileage?

The mileage advertised by a manufacturer is generally measured under controlled testing conditions. Your actual or real-world mileage can be different because everyday driving involves traffic, acceleration, braking, idling, passengers, luggage, air conditioning, road gradients and varying speeds.

Real-world mileage is therefore the mileage your vehicle actually delivers during normal driving.

For a more reliable result, calculate your mileage over a longer distance and repeat the test several times.

How To Check Your Car's Real Mileage

The most reliable way to measure real-world car mileage is the full-tank-to-full-tank method.

Step 1: Fill The Fuel Tank

Fill your car with fuel until the fuel pump nozzle automatically cuts off. Try to use the same filling method every time.

Step 2: Reset The Trip Meter

Reset your trip meter to zero. If your vehicle does not have a trip meter, record the odometer reading.

Step 3: Drive Normally

Drive your vehicle as you normally would. Avoid deliberately changing your driving style simply to achieve a higher mileage figure.

Step 4: Refill The Tank

When you need to refuel, fill the tank again using the same method.

Step 5: Record The Distance And Fuel

Note the distance travelled and the amount of fuel added during the refill.

Step 6: Calculate Mileage

Use:

Mileage = Distance Travelled ÷ Fuel Added

For example:

  • Distance travelled = 520 km
  • Fuel added = 32 litres

Mileage = 520 ÷ 32 = 16.25 km/l

This gives you a practical estimate of your vehicle's real-world mileage.

Petrol vs Diesel vs CNG Mileage

Different fuel types have different efficiency and running-cost characteristics.

Petrol Mileage

Petrol cars are common for city driving and typically offer smooth performance and lower upfront costs. Petrol mileage can vary significantly with traffic, driving style, engine size and transmission.

Diesel Mileage

Diesel vehicles can deliver strong fuel efficiency, particularly during longer-distance and highway driving. Diesel mileage also depends on vehicle weight, engine technology, transmission and driving conditions.

CNG Mileage

CNG vehicles are generally measured in km/kg rather than km/l. CNG can offer a lower running cost per kilometre in areas where CNG is readily available.

Electric Vehicle Efficiency

Electric vehicles do not use petrol, diesel or CNG. Their efficiency is measured using electricity consumption, commonly as km/kWh or kWh/100 km.

EV Mileage And Efficiency Calculator

For electric vehicles, mileage is better understood as energy efficiency.

The basic formula is:

EV Efficiency = Distance Travelled ÷ Energy Consumed

For example, if an EV travels 300 km while consuming 45 kWh:

300 ÷ 45 = 6.67 km/kWh

The calculator can also estimate:

  • EV efficiency
  • Energy consumption
  • Charging cost
  • Cost per kilometre
  • Estimated full-charge range

Actual EV range and efficiency can change with speed, traffic, temperature, terrain, tyre pressure, driving style, air-conditioning use and vehicle load.

What Factors Affect Car Mileage?

Your vehicle's mileage can change considerably depending on how and where you drive.

Driving Style

Aggressive acceleration, hard braking and high-speed driving can increase fuel consumption. Smooth acceleration and anticipating traffic can help improve fuel efficiency.

Traffic

Stop-and-go city traffic generally reduces mileage because of frequent acceleration, braking and engine idling.

Tyre Pressure

Incorrect tyre pressure can affect rolling resistance and fuel efficiency. Check your tyre pressure regularly and maintain it according to the vehicle manufacturer's recommendation.

Air Conditioning

Using the air conditioner increases the energy demand on the vehicle and can affect fuel efficiency, particularly during slow-speed city driving.

Vehicle Load

Carrying additional passengers, luggage or other heavy loads increases the vehicle's weight and can reduce mileage.

Road Conditions

Hilly roads, poor road surfaces, strong winds and frequent elevation changes can increase energy or fuel consumption.

Vehicle Maintenance

Engine condition, air filters, spark plugs, engine oil, wheel alignment and tyre condition can all influence fuel efficiency.

Speed

Driving at very high speeds generally increases aerodynamic drag and can reduce fuel economy. Maintaining a steady and sensible speed can help improve efficiency.

How To Improve Your Car's Mileage

You can often improve fuel efficiency by adopting a few simple driving and maintenance habits:

  • Maintain the recommended tyre pressure.
  • Avoid unnecessary hard acceleration and braking.
  • Avoid prolonged engine idling.
  • Maintain a steady speed whenever possible.
  • Remove unnecessary weight from the vehicle.
  • Keep up with scheduled servicing.
  • Check wheel alignment if the vehicle pulls to one side.
  • Avoid carrying unnecessary luggage.
  • Use the air conditioner sensibly.
  • Plan routes to reduce unnecessary traffic and stop-start driving.
  • Monitor your mileage regularly to identify changes in fuel efficiency.

Why Is My Car Giving Low Mileage?

A sudden drop in mileage does not always mean there is a major mechanical problem.

Low mileage can be caused by:

  • Heavy traffic
  • Frequent short-distance trips
  • Aggressive acceleration
  • Excessive idling
  • Low tyre pressure
  • Incorrect wheel alignment
  • Increased vehicle load
  • Extensive air-conditioner use
  • Poor road conditions
  • High-speed driving
  • Poor-quality or unsuitable fuel
  • Delayed vehicle maintenance
  • Engine or transmission-related issues

If your vehicle's mileage drops significantly and remains low despite normal driving and correct maintenance, it may be worth having the vehicle inspected by a qualified technician.

What Is A Good Car Mileage?

There is no single mileage figure that can be considered good for every vehicle.

A small petrol hatchback, diesel SUV, CNG car and high-performance petrol car will naturally have different fuel-efficiency levels.

Your vehicle's mileage depends on:

  • Engine size
  • Vehicle weight
  • Fuel type
  • Transmission
  • Tyre size
  • Driving conditions
  • Traffic
  • Driving style
  • Terrain
  • Maintenance

Instead of comparing your mileage with another vehicle directly, compare your actual mileage with your vehicle's expected real-world mileage and monitor whether it changes over time.

What is kmpl?

KMPL means kilometres per litre. It represents how many kilometres a vehicle can travel using one litre of fuel.

For example, 18 kmpl means the vehicle can theoretically travel 18 kilometres using one litre of fuel under the measured conditions.

What is MPG?

MPG stands for miles per gallon and is commonly used in countries such as the United States.

The exact conversion depends on whether you are using US gallons or Imperial gallons, so always check the measurement system before comparing MPG figures.

Is higher mileage always better?

Higher mileage generally means lower fuel consumption for the same distance, but mileage should not be considered in isolation.

Vehicle price, performance, safety, comfort, maintenance costs and intended usage are also important when comparing vehicles.

Why is my real-world mileage different from the claimed mileage?

Manufacturer mileage figures are generated under controlled test conditions. Real-world driving includes traffic, passengers, air conditioning, acceleration, braking, road conditions and different speeds.

Because of these factors, your actual mileage can differ from the claimed figure.
